PM5-KHD LED Panel Indicator Equivalent & Substitute Parts
Part Overview
The PM5-KHD is a panel-mounted LED indicator manufactured by Bivar Inc., designed for applications requiring a red diffused lens with 25 millicandela brightness output at 625nm wavelength. This component operates at 2V with a maximum current of 20mA and features a 120° viewing angle with a 9.91mm round panel cutout.
The PM5-KHD is classified as obsolete. Locating equivalent or substitute components is necessary to support ongoing maintenance, repair, and new design requirements where this part is specified or functionally required.

Engineering Selection Recommendations
PM5-PHD Selection Criteria:
The PM5-PHD is the active production equivalent within the PM5 series. It maintains identical optical and mechanical specifications to the PM5-KHD, ensuring direct panel cutout compatibility and visual performance characteristics.
Selection of the PM5-PHD is appropriate when:
- The application circuit operates within the 8V to 48V AC/DC range
- Integrated wiring termination is acceptable or preferred over direct solder connections
- Enhanced ingress protection (IP67) is required or beneficial for the installation environment
- Active product status and ongoing availability are required for production or long-term support
PM5-KHD Retention Criteria:
The PM5-KHD remains the only option when:
- The application circuit operates at exactly 2V
- Direct panel termination without integrated wiring is required
- Existing inventory of PM5-KHD components is available and acceptable for use
The PM5-KHD is classified as obsolete. New designs should incorporate the PM5-PHD to ensure long-term component availability and supply chain continuity.
Frequently Asked Questions (FAQ)
Q: Can the PM5-PHD directly replace the PM5-KHD in an existing 2V circuit?
A: No. The PM5-PHD is rated for 8V ~ 48V operation. Applying 2V to the PM5-PHD will result in insufficient forward voltage and non-functional operation. The PM5-KHD must be retained for 2V applications.
Q: Are the optical outputs identical between PM5-KHD and PM5-PHD?
A: Yes. Both components produce identical red light output at 625nm wavelength with 25mcd brightness and 120° viewing angle. The diffused white lens provides identical light distribution characteristics.
Q: Will the PM5-PHD fit the same panel cutout as the PM5-KHD?
A: Yes. Both components require a 0.39" (9.91mm) round panel cutout. The mechanical form factor is identical, allowing direct panel mounting compatibility.
Q: What is the difference between the termination styles?
A: The PM5-KHD uses direct panel termination for solder connection. The PM5-PHD includes integrated wiring for connection to external circuits. The PM5-PHD is supplied in a bag package format.
Q: Does the PM5-PHD provide better environmental protection?
A: Yes. The PM5-PHD carries an IP67 ingress protection rating, providing sealed protection against dust and temporary water immersion. The PM5-KHD does not specify an ingress protection rating.
Q: Are both parts RoHS compliant?
A: The PM5-PHD is explicitly RoHS3 compliant. The PM5-KHD RoHS status is not specified in the provided data. Both parts carry ECCN EAR99 classification and HTSUS code 8541.41.0000.
Q: What is the current consumption for both parts?
A: Both the PM5-KHD and PM5-PHD are rated for a maximum current of 20mA. This specification is identical across both components.
Q: Why is the PM5-KHD classified as obsolete?
A: The PM5-KHD is no longer in active production. The PM5-PHD serves as the current production equivalent within the PM5 series, offering enhanced features including integrated wiring and IP67 protection while maintaining identical optical and mechanical specifications.
